FIFA president Sepp Blatter pledged zero tolerance to corruption when he faced media in Rio three days after former Asian Football Confederation president Mohamed bin Hammam was banned for life for his involvement in the bribery-for-votes scam.
Blatter said there would be'zero tolerance for everybody, on the pitch and off it... not only for my neighbour, my friends, my colleagues, my opponents, referees, but also for presidents of associations"
Blatter refused to make any comment on his former ally Hammam's punishment.
He is currently in Rio for the 2014 World Cup draw which takes place on Saturday.
